Common Roof Shingle Issues in Denver

Denver experiences a range of weather conditions that can impact shingles:

  • **Sun Damage:** Intense UV rays can cause shingles to become brittle and lose their protective granules over time, leading to premature aging and potential leaks.
  • **Hail Damage:** Denver and the surrounding Front Range are susceptible to hailstorms, which can crack, puncture, or dislodge shingles, creating immediate vulnerabilities.
  • **Wind Damage:** Strong winds, common in the Denver area, can lift or tear shingles away, exposing the underlayment to the elements.
  • **Granule Loss:** As shingles age or are subjected to harsh weather, they can lose their protective granules, making them less effective against UV rays and water.
  • **Cracked or Curling Shingles:** These are often signs of age or extreme temperature fluctuations, leading to potential water intrusion.

Inspection and Assessment

A qualified Denver roofer will meticulously examine your roof, looking for obvious signs of damage such as missing shingles, cracked or curled materials, and areas where granules have accumulated in gutters. They will also check for compromised flashing, which is common around penetrations like chimneys, vents, and skylights. This detailed assessment allows them to identify all areas requiring attention, providing you with a clear understanding of the issues.

Material Selection and Matching

A key aspect of successful shingle repair is matching the existing shingles. Roofing contractors in Denver have extensive experience working with the various shingle types and colors prevalent in the region. They will strive to source shingles that are as close a match as possible to your current roofing to maintain aesthetic consistency, ensuring that the repaired sections blend seamlessly with the rest of your roof. Common shingle materials include three-tab asphalt shingles, architectural or dimensional shingles, and sometimes even specialized impact-resistant shingles that offer enhanced protection against hail.

Repair Techniques

The actual shingle repair process involves careful removal of damaged shingles and the installation of new ones. This often entails gently lifting the surrounding shingles to access and remove the compromised ones. New shingles are then carefully nailed into place, ensuring proper overlap and sealing to prevent water infiltration. For flashing repair, professionals will remove old sealant and caulk, then re-seal or replace damaged flashing to create a watertight barrier. In some cases, if minor damage is found on an otherwise healthy roof, a specific technique involving specialized roofing cement to secure loose shingles might be employed.

Preventing Water Damage

Missing or damaged shingles create openings for water to seep into your roof system. In Denver, even small amounts of water intrusion during a rain shower or snow melt can lead to rot in the roof decking, insulation damage, and mold growth within your attic and walls. Early repair prevents these widespread and expensive issues.

Storm Risk & Climate Factors — Denver, Colorado

The county surrounding Denver averages 9.7 significant hail events per year (hail diameter ≥ 1"). High-wind events average 3.5 per year. At this frequency, hail damage is a recurring concern — granule loss often creates hidden weak points that only manifest as interior leaks 12–24 months later. Source: NOAA National Centers for Environmental Information, Storm Events Database, 2014–2023.

With 5,687 annual heating degree days, Denver is in a climate where ice dams are a real seasonal hazard — attic heat escapes through the roof deck, melts snow, and the meltwater refreezes at the cold eaves, backing up under shingles and causing interior moisture damage. Proper attic insulation, air sealing, and ice-and-water shield at the eaves are the primary defenses. Source: Open-Meteo ERA5 Climate Reanalysis, 2014–2023 average.

Will homeowners insurance cover Roof Shingle Repair in Denver?

Insurance typically covers sudden storm damage — hail, wind, and falling trees — but not gradual wear or pre-existing deterioration. Given Denver's average of 9.7 significant hail events per year, storm-damage claims are relatively common in this area. Document all damage with photos immediately after a storm and contact your insurer before any repair work begins.

Can I do Roof Shingle Repair myself?

Replacing one or two displaced shingles is manageable for a confident DIYer with proper ladder safety; flashing repairs around chimneys and valleys require complex sealing and are best handled by a licensed roofer

EPA Radon Zone 1 — Denver County

Denver County is classified as EPA Radon Zone 1 — the highest potential for elevated indoor radon (4+ pCi/L per EPA action level). While roofing work itself does not directly affect radon, adequate attic ventilation and sealed roof penetrations help control attic air pressure, which influences soil-gas draw through the foundation. A radon test is recommended for any home in Zone 1 counties, particularly after major weatherization or re-roofing projects. Source: U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, Map of Radon Zones, 2024.
